- [ ] **Step 7: Breaker override escrow.** After sealing the signing keys for the Tallgrove upstream API circuit breaker, confirm the support team can force the breaker open during a full outage. The override bundle lives in the sealed escrow drawer and is useless without its unlock phrase. Two ceremony witnesses must initial this step before proceeding. The escrow bundle is decrypted with the recovery passphrase that follows.

vault phrase of kahip-kahop = holath-quenmir

Handover Note — Director Transition, Quillbrook Media

From: P. Ostrander. To: L. Venn.

The marketing budget is cut 22% for the coming fiscal year. Sponsorships in the Darlowe region are cancelled; the Brightline campaign continues at reduced spend. Agency retainers renegotiated last month — contracts are filed with finance. Monthly variance reports continue as before.

The strategic reasoning behind the cut is set out in the confidential note below.

confidential, bahof-yaweg: Headcount on the Kaseth team goes from 32 to 109 by the end of January. Gross margin on Kaseth came in at 46 percent against a plan of 45 percent.

### Drivers not assigned in Quellton region

The Fleetmark heuristic skips drivers whose availability window straddles midnight. Check the wraparound logic in the scorer before filing anything else. To replay a failed assignment batch, call the replay endpoint with the batch date. The endpoint requires the staging auth header shown below.

portal login ticket: eyJhbGciOiJIUzI1NiIsInR5cCI6IkpXVCJ9.eyJzdWIiOiIMjvRAf3PEFIn0.nuv9gjixLtnr

Visiting contractors, please note: the Varnholt Building mail room has moved from the ground floor to Annex C, beside the loading dock. All parcel deliveries and pickups must now go through the Annex C entrance. Sign in at the dock window first. The door to Annex C requires the following pass code.

badge for fafop-fajof: bdg-Z-47